|
Business Combinations (Tables)
|12 Months Ended
Mar. 31, 2024
|The Smart Cube [Member]
|
|Statement [LineItems]
|
|Purchase Price Allocation to Assets Acquired and Liabilities Assumed
|The purchase price has been allocated, as set out below, to the assets acquired and liabilities assumed in the business combination.
|
|
|
|
|
|
|
|
|
|
Cash
|
|$
|6,777
|
|
Trade receivables
|
|
|6,672
|
|
Unbilled revenue
|
|
|1,775
|
|
Prepayment and other current assets
|
|
|961
|
|
Property and equipment
|
|
|319
|
|
|
|
|1,781
|
|
Intangible assets
|
|
|
|
|
- Customer relationships
|
|
|26,759
|
|
- Customer contracts
|
|
|1,972
|
|
|
|
|1,309
|
|
- Software
|
|
|1,305
|
|
|
|
|1,284
|
|
Deferred tax assets
|
|
|1,372
|
|
Current liabilities
|
|
|(6,241
|)
|
|
|
|(1,352
|)
|
Lease liabilities
|
|
|(1,736
|)
|
Deferred tax liabilities
|
|
|(7,758
|)
|
|
|
|
|
|
|
|
|
|
|
Less: Purchase consideration
|
|
|(121,643
|)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|OptiBuy [Member]
|
|Statement [LineItems]
|
|Purchase Price Allocation to Assets Acquired and Liabilities Assumed
|The purchase price has been allocated, as set out below, to the assets acquired and liabilities assumed in the business combination.
|
|
|
|
|
|
|
|
|
|
Cash
|
|$
|1,081
|
|
Trade receivables
|
|
|1,936
|
|
Unbilled revenue
|
|
|294
|
|
Prepayment and other current assets
|
|
|355
|
|
Property and equipment
|
|
|45
|
|
|
|
|238
|
|
Intangible assets
|
|
|
|
|
- Customer relationships
|
|
|3,434
|
|
- Customer contracts
|
|
|932
|
|
|
|
|956
|
|
- Software
|
|
|122
|
|
|
|
|590
|
|
Deferred tax assets
|
|
|17
|
|
Current liabilities
|
|
|(2,557
|)
|
|
|
|(53
|)
|
Lease liabilities
|
|
|(234
|)
|
Deferred tax liabilities
|
|
|(1,027
|)
|
|
|
|
|
|
|
|
|
|
|
Less: Purchase consideration
|
|
|(31,756
|)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Large Insurance Company [Member]
|
|Statement [LineItems]
|
|Purchase Price Allocation to Assets Acquired and Liabilities Assumed
|
The purchase price has been allocated, as set out below:
|
|
|
|
|
|
|
|
|
|
Intangible assets
|
|
|
|
|
- Customer contracts
|
|$
|37,890
|
|
Deferred tax liabilities
|
|
|(9,300
|)
|
|
|
|
|
|
|
|
|
|
|
Less: Purchase consideration
|
|
|(44,000
|)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Vuram Technology Solutions [Member]
|
|Statement [LineItems]
|
|Purchase Price Allocation to Assets Acquired and Liabilities Assumed
|The purchase price has been allocated, as set out below, to the assets acquired and liabilities assumed in the business combination.
|
|
|
|
|
|
|
|
|
|
Cash
|
|$
|4,670
|
|
Investments
|
|
|11,235
|
|
Trade receivables
|
|
|6,738
|
|
Unbilled revenue
|
|
|705
|
|
Prepayment and other current assets
|
|
|1,633
|
|
Property and equipment
|
|
|707
|
|
|
|
|1,498
|
|
Intangible assets
|
|
|
|
|
- Customer relationships
|
|
|45,331
|
|
- Customer contracts
|
|
|5,267
|
|
|
|
|5,001
|
|
- Software & Trade name
|
|
|92
|
|
|
|
|375
|
|
Deferred tax assets
|
|
|632
|
|
Current liabilities
|
|
|(7,799
|)
|
|
|
|(1,265
|)
|
Lease liabilities
|
|
|(1,470
|)
|
Deferred tax liabilities
|
|
|(13,717
|)
|
|
|
|
|
|
|
|
|
|
|
Less: Purchase consideration
|
|
|(170,347
|)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|MOL Information Processing Services (I) Private Limited [Member]
|
|Statement [LineItems]
|
|Purchase Price Allocation to Assets Acquired and Liabilities Assumed
|The purchase price has been allocated, as set out below, to the assets acquired and liabilities assumed in the business combination.
|
|
|
|
|
|
|
|
|
|
Total assets
|
|$
|3,981
|
|
Less: Total liabilities
|
|
|(2,321
|)
|
|
|
|
|
|
Net assets acquired
|
|
|1,660
|
|
Less: Purchase consideration
|
|
|(2,958
|)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|